esp8266 server

Petr Zapadlo zapik na email.cz
Sobota Leden 18 16:10:37 CET 2025


Zdravím,

V http lze nastavit parametr refresh

https://developer.mozilla.org/en-US/docs/Web/HTTP/Headers/Refresh

který způsobí opakované načítání stránky.

A dívám se, že pracujete s esp8266 s "originálním" firmware, který se 
ovládá přes seriový port AT příkazy. Mě to přijde strašně těžkopádné, 
nechcete do toho nalít svůj vlastní firmware ve kterém si uděláte co 
potřebujete?

Petr

Dne 18. 01. 25 v 15:53 Fanda Kopriva napsal(a):
> dobry den
>
> Hraju si s ESP8266.Mam pripojeny zarizeni pres udp do pc (vlastniho 
> programu).
>
> Rad bych ho pripojil do prohlizece.Prosim zkusenejsi o radu.Viz vypis 
> dole.
>
> Inicializace probehne v poradku.
>
> Do prohlizece zadam adresu modulu .
>
> Z modulu vypisu v prohlizeci dve radky "AHOJ TADY CHATA"
>
>      Prvni dotaz - muzu nejakym komandem prohlizeci rict , aby se 
> stranka nacetla znovu ?
>
>     tj. po prvnim textu  "AHOJ TADY CHATA" zacit znovu , resetovat 
> stranku a znovu napsat "AHOJ TADY CHATA"
>
> Zobrazim dotazovaci pole v prohlizeci.
>
> Kdyz vyplnene pole odeslu z prohlizece, tak dorazi do ESP v poradku 
> ,ale od te doby neprijde nic dalsiho z esp do prohlizece
>
> i kdyz komand CIPSEND je spokojeny.Ale vyplnene pole projdou z 
> prohlizece do ESP bez problemu.
>
>     Druhy dotaz - Je potreba nejak potvrdit prijaty data z prohlizece 
> nebo jak znovuzprovoznit komunikaci do prohlizece
>
> Dekuju fanda
>
>
>
> -----------------------------------------inicializace 
> ESP8266----------------------------------------
>
>    O 0> AT+CWMODE=3__
> I 1: AT+CWMODE=3_____OK__
>
>    O 1> AT+CWQAP__
> I 2: AT+CWQAP_____OK__WIFI DISCONNECT__
>
>    O 2> AT+RST__
> I 3> AT+RST_____OK____ ets Jan  8 2013,rst cause:1, boot 
> mode:(3,7)____load 0x40100000,
> len 2408, room 16 __tail 8__chksum0xe5__load 0x3ffe8000, len 776, room 
> 0 __tail 8__chksum 0x84_
> _load 0x3ffe8310, len 632, room 0 __tail 8__chksum 0xd8__csum 
> 0xd8____2nd boot version : 1.6__
> SPI Speed      : 40MHz__SPI Mode       : QOUT__  SPI Flash Size & Map: 
> 16Mbit(512KB+512KB)__
> jump to run user1 @ 1000_________8__n____r___n_b______I 6____r_8_G_l_ 
> #_____r______I8_____
> ______r______I8_____0____l_r__r______l____b______b__b____l__l__b___b___~_n__n_________l___n_$ 
>
> ___________l___________l`___`_______b______l_8_________b_______|__r__r____ready__WIFI 
> CONNECTED
> __WIFI GOT IP__
>
>    O 3> AT+CWJAP="chatabubu","huygtfrdr"__
> I 9: AT+CWJAP="chatabubu","huygtfrdr"___WIFI DISCONNECT__WIFI 
> CONNECTED__WIFI GOT IP____OK__
>
>    O 4> AT+CIFSR__
> I 12: 
> AT+CIFSR___+CIFSR:APIP,"192.168.4.1"__+CIFSR:APMAC,"b6:e6:2d:15:0c:4e"__+CIFSR:STAIP,"192.168.1.52"_
> _+CIFSR:STAMAC,"b4:e6:2d:15:0c:4e"____OK__
>
>    O 5> AT+CIPMUX=1__
> I 13: AT+CIPMUX=1_____OK__
>
>    O 6> AT+CIPSERVER=1,80__
> I 14: AT+CIPSERVER=1,80_____OK__0,CONNECT__1,CONNECT____
>
> --------------------------------------------konec inicializace 
> ---------------------------------
>
> ---------------------------------  pozadavek prohlizece na zobrazeni 
> stranky --------------------
>
> +IPD,1,462:GET / HTTP/1.1__Host: 192.168.1.52__Connection: 
> keep-alive__Cache-Control: max-age=
> 0__Upgrade-Insecure-Requests: 1__User-Agent: Mozilla/5.0 (Windows NT 
> 10.0; Win64; x64) AppleWebKit/537
> .36 (KHTML, like Gecko) Chrome/131.0.0.0 Safari/537.36__Accept: 
> text/html,application/xhtml+xml,
> application/xml;q=0.9,image/avif,image/webp,image/apng,*/*;q=0.8,application/signed-exc 
>
> hange;v=b3;q=0.7__Accept-Encoding: gzip, deflate__Accept-Language: 
> cs,en-US;q=0.9,en;q=0.8____2,CONNECT__
>
> ----------------------------------- zobrazeni dvou radek textu v 
> prohlizeci -------------------------
>
>    O 7> AT+CIPSEND=0,45__
> I 17: AT+CIPSEND=0,45_____OK__>
>    O 8> <h1>AHOJ TADY CHATA</h1><body bgcolor=f0f0f0>
> I 18: _____busy s...____Recv 45 bytes____SEND OK__
>
>    O 7> AT+CIPSEND=0,45__
> I 17: AT+CIPSEND=0,45_____OK__>
>    O 8> <h1>AHOJ TADY CHATA</h1><body bgcolor=f0f0f0>
> I 18: _____busy s...____Recv 45 bytes____SEND OK__
>
> -----------------------------------  zobrazeni dotazovaciho pole v 
> prohlizeci --------------------
>    O 9> AT+CIPSEND=0,121__
> I 23: AT+CIPSEND=0,121_____OK__>
>    O 10> <form action="stranka.html">Stav zamku:<input type=text 
> size=16 name="zamek"><input type=submit value=odeslat></form>__
> I 24> ___busy s...____Recv 121 bytes____SEND OK__
>
> ----------------------------------- odeslani pozadavku z prohlizece na 
> esp2866 --------------------
>
> I 25:__+IPD,1,493:GEI 26: T /stranka.html?zamek=yguyguu 
> HTTP/1.1__Host: 192.168.1.52__Connection: keep-aliv
> e__Upgrade-Insecure-Requests: 1__User-Agent: Mozilla/5.0 (Windows NT 
> 10.0; Win64;
>  x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/131.0.0.0 
> Safari/537.36__Acce
> pt: 
> text/html,application/xhtml+xml,application/xml;q=0.9,image/avif,image/webp,i
> mage/apng,*/*;q=0.8,application/signed-exchange;v=b3;q=0.7__Referer: 
> http://192.1
> 68.1.52/__Accept-Encoding: gzip, deflate__Accept-Language: 
> cs,en-US;q=0.9,en;q=0.8____
>
> ------------ po odeslani se prestanou prenaset data do prohlizece i 
> kdyz SEND je potvrzeny --------------
> ------------- ale data z prohlizece do esp nadale prochazeji 
> -------------------------------------------
>
>    O 11> AT+CIPSEND=0,45__
> I 27: AT+CIPSEND=0,45_____OK__>
>    O 12> <h1>AHOJ TADY CHATA</h1><body bgcolor=f0f0f0>_____busy 
> s...____Recv 45 bytes____SEND OK__
>
> I 28: 1,CLOSED__1,CONNECT__
>
> I 29: __+IPD,1,462:GET / HTTP/1.1__Host: 192.168.1.52__Connection: 
> keep-alive__Cache-Control: max-age=
> 0__Upgrade-Insecure-Requests: 1__User-Agent: Mozilla/5.0 (Windows NT 
> 10.0; Win64;
>  x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/131.0.0.0 
> Safari/537.36__Acce
> pt: 
> text/html,application/xhtml+xml,application/xml;q=0.9,image/avif,image/webp,i
> mage/apng,*/*;q=0.8,application/signed-exchange;v=b3;q=0.7__Accept-E
> ncoding: gzip, deflate__Accept-Language: cs,en-US;q=0.9,en;q=0.8____
>
> I 30: __+IPD,1,493:GEI 26: T /stranka.html?zamek=yguyguu 
> HTTP/1.1__Host: 192.168.1.52__Connection: keep-aliv
> e__Upgrade-Insecure-Requests: 1__User-Agent: Mozilla/5.0 (Windows NT 
> 10.0; Win64;
>  x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/131.0.0.0 
> Safari/537.36__Acce
> pt: 
> text/html,application/xhtml+xml,application/xml;q=0.9,image/avif,image/webp,i
> mage/apng,*/*;q=0.8,application/signed-exchange;v=b3;q=0.7__Referer: 
> http://192.1
> 68.1.52/__Accept-Encoding: gzip, deflate__Accept-Language: 
> cs,en-US;q=0.9,en;q=0.8____
>
>    O 13> AT+CIPSEND=0,45__
> I 31: AT+CIPSEND=0,45_____OK__>
>    O 14> <h1>AHOJ TADY CHATA</h1><body bgcolor=f0f0f0>_____busy 
> s...____Recv 45 bytes____SEND OK__
>
> -------------------------------------------------------------------------------------------------------------- 
>
>
> _______________________________________________
> HW-list mailing list  -  sponsored by www.HW.cz
> Hw-list na list.hw.cz
> http://list.hw.cz/mailman/listinfo/hw-list


Další informace o konferenci Hw-list